Belmont consolidated their position with a 6 wicket victory over Wearmouth. Batting first Wearmouth made 144 all out. J McGonnell top scored with 63 not out. Whilst C Milnethorpe took the bulk of the wickets taking 4 for 17. In reply A Bowery 42 and P Cosford 41 not out, combined to see belmont home with 6 wickets to spare, K Philliskirk was the pick of the Wearmouh bowlers taking 2 for 19.
Burnhope also maintained their second place with a victory over table climbers South Hetton. Batting first Burnhope made 212 all out, with the a team effort adding the runs. D Cane 38, M Fraser 30 and G Dawson 36 were the top scorers, A Hillas took 3 for 15 for Hetton. South Hetton were then bowled out for 182, 30 runs short of the target. T Franks was the top scorer with 67 and M Fraser took 3 for 24 for the victors.
The final two games saw the four bottom clubs meet. Beamish and East Rainton ran out the victors on the day. Beamish hosted Stanhope and the home team batted first. Ending the innings on 165 for 6, G Shaw was the top scorer with 49. Whilst A Robinson took 2 for 18 for the dalesmen. After tea Hope were bowled out for 154, just 11 runs short of their target. H Muse was the top scorer with 38, whilst C Pither took 3 for 34 and A Simblett 4 for 27.
The final match saw East Rainton host Coundon, Coundon batted first making 121 all out, T Little was the top scorer with 33, whilst C Henderson Jnr took 3 for 14. In reply N Matthews posted 58 as Rainton lost two wickets passing the total. T Little took 1 for 16 and M Howe 1 for 27 for Coundon.

The Johnson/coates final took place on Saturday, with Burnhope (171 for 7) beating Kimblesworth (169 for 9). Congratulations to Burnhope CC.
The Amos Lowing/Wilson shield final took place on Sunday, with Kimblesworth (169 for 7) beating Kibblesworth (118 for 10). Congratulations to Kimblesworth CC.
